Hi Nick,

Mikealder is the expert on smartphones but Memory Map usually runs alright on Windows Mobile devices.

Install the application from within MM (to transfer the license key) and then it's quicker to copy maps directly to the memory card. .QCT map files may need to be cut to less than about 300MBytes each, then also copy .QED elevation data and .MMI placenames index files if available.

That phone doesn't have a touch screen but there is a version of Memory Map that can be loaded to that type of phone - I used it on the wife's MPVc600 a few years ago and to be honest I wasn't too impressed with the software in use on the phone, its too limitted in terms of capability, but it does work showing your position from a GPS receiver on the map.

You will need one of the more recent Memory Map versions as SmartPhone support was introduced as a small update to the version 5 Memory Map, if you have version 5 great, if you only have pre V5 then your maps won't work with the version 5 software and there isn't earlier MM to run on SmartPhone - Mike
